Senior Specialist, Stock Administration
The Senior Specialist, Stock Administration is responsible for the administration, analysis, and operational delivery of the company’s global equity and stock-based compensation programs. This role supports core processes including equity grants, vesting, exercises, employee stock purchase programs (ESPP), and compliance activities, ensuring accuracy, timeliness, and a strong employee experience.
Working closely with Compensation, Payroll, Finance, Legal and external vendors, you will play a key role in maintaining data integrity, supporting reporting and regulatory requirements, and ensuring effective day‑to‑day execution of stock administration programs within a global environment.

Key Responsibilities- Administer global equity and non‑qualified programs including, but not limited to, stock option grants, RSUs, performance awards, elective deferral and ESPP, ensuring accurate processing of grants, vesting, exercises and transactions.
- Execute day‑to‑day stock administration activities, including data uploads, reconciliations and coordination with Payroll for equity‑related transactions and tax withholding.
- Partner with external stock plan vendors (e.g., Fidelity or similar) to ensure accurate recordkeeping, transaction processing and issue resolution.
- Maintain data integrity across stock administration systems and HRIS platforms, preparing standard and ad‑hoc reports for Compensation, Finance and leadership.
- Support compliance with regulatory requirements and internal controls, including SOX, insider trading policies and audit requests.
- Respond to employee inquiries related to equity programs, transactions and participation, providing clear and timely support.
- Assist in employee communications and education efforts related to stock plans and financial wellness.
- Support annual and cyclical processes such as grant cycles, vesting events, ESPP enrollments and dividend payments.
- Contribute to system enhancements, process improvements and implementation of new programs or vendors.
